What is the local rule 1.06 in Sacramento Superior court?
1.06 Tentative Ruling System. (A) In all civil law and motion, writ, and other departments as designated, a Tentative Ruling System is utilized. On the afternoon of the court day before each calendar, the judge will publish a tentative ruling on each matter on the next day's calendar. -
What is a EJ 130 form?
Tells the sheriff to take action to enforce a judgment. Used with instructions to the sheriff to levy bank accounts, garnish wages, or take possession of personal property. Get form EJ-130. Effective: September 1, 2020. -
How do I file a motion in Sacramento Superior court?
Motions heard in the Law and Motion departments (Department 53 or Department 54) may be filed at the Hall of Justice Building, 813 6th Street, second floor or in the Civil Law and Motion Drop Box located in the Public Service Lobby on the first floor, or may be submitted by mail. -

What is debtor examination?
If you need information about what the person or business who owes you money earns or owns, you can get a court order for them to come to court to answer questions (called a debtor's examination) about what they earn or own. You can use this information to try to collect the money owed to you. -
How do you avoid a debtor's exam?
The main ways to legally avoid appearing at a debtor examination are to pay off the debt or signNow a settlement with the creditor that provides a way for paying back the debt. You also may be able to avoid the examination by filing for bankruptcy, which will trigger an automatic stay of collection efforts. -

What is the application and order for appearance and examination in California?
Asks the court to order, and orders the judgment debtor or a third party holding the judgment debtor's property to appear at court to answer your questions about their finances to help you learn how you might collect your judgment.
